Ravi Shankar Appointed as Group Chief Human Resources Officer at Shyam Metallics

Kolkata, West Bengal, India, July 2025 – Shyam Metallics, a leading integrated metal producer with operations across West Bengal, Jharkhand, Odisha, and Madhya Pradesh, has appointed Ravi Shankar as its new Group Chief Human Resources Officer (CHRO). His appointment comes at a critical juncture as the company embarks on a transformative growth phase, and he will be tasked with leading group-wide HR planning, leadership development, policy transformation, and cultural integration across all business verticals.

A seasoned HR professional with over 29 years of experience, Ravi Shankar is widely recognized for his strategic HR leadership in the manufacturing, steel, power, and textile sectors. His distinguished career includes leadership roles at Jindal Steel & Power, Welspun India, Adani Power, Spice Energy, and most recently at Jai Raj Steel, where he served as President & CHRO overseeing HR across four high-growth business units.

During his tenure at Jindal Steel & Power, Ravi led HR and administration at the Angul mega plant—managing a 25,000-strong workforce—and played a key role in driving workforce strategies for one of India’s largest greenfield steel expansions. He has also been instrumental in leading HR operations for multi-site power projects at Adani and Jindal Power, including a 2400 MW expansion project delivered in record time under his guidance.

Ravi Shankar’s contributions to the HR domain have been widely acclaimed, earning him prestigious awards such as the ATD Best Award (2018), ATD Practice & Citation Award (2015), Dale Carnegie Global Leadership Award, and the People Matters Learning Transformation Award. Under his leadership, Jindal Power was recognized among India’s Top 50 Great Places to Work in 2015, and he has consistently been featured in top HR leader lists by reputed media houses.

Ravi holds an MBA in Human Resource Management from L.N. Mishra Institute of Economic Development and Social Change (LNMI) and completed the Advanced Human Resource Management (AHRM) program from Indian Institute of Management Ahmedabad.

His appointment underscores Shyam Metallics’ commitment to strengthening its human capital strategy and building a high-performance culture to support its ambitious expansion roadmap.

About Shyam Metallics and Energy Limited
Shyam Metallics is one of India’s leading integrated metal producers, focused on long steel products and ferro alloys. With three major manufacturing plants in Odisha and West Bengal, a combined capacity of 2.90 MTPA, and captive power capabilities, the company operates two integrated “ore to metal” plants and serves both domestic and international markets. Shyam Metallics continues to build on its reputation for operational excellence, agility, and market responsiveness.
